WebRailroad grants Checkerboarding in the West occurred due to railroad land grants where railroads would be granted every other section along a rail corridor. These grants, which typically extended 6 to 40 miles (10 to 64 km) from either side of the track, [2] were a subsidy to the railroads.

In the nineteenth and twentieth centuries, the United States government granted railroads thousands of miles of rights of way out of the federal public lands. Court decisions, led by an influential 1942 opinion by the United States Supreme Court, have held that there was a major shift in federal right of way granting policy in 1871 ...

WebLand grants to railroads were made in broad belts along the proposed route. Within these belts the railroads were allowed to chose alternative mile-square sections in checkerboard fashion.
